#Brazil #Waterfall #ecotourism #national #park #travel #trekking #landscape The Chapada Diamantina National Park (Portuguese: Parque Nacional da Chapada Diamantina) is a national park in the Chapada Diamantina region of the State of Bahia, Brazil. The terrain is rugged, and mainly covered by flora of the Caatinga biome. The park is classed as IUCN protected area category II (national park). It has the objectives of preserving natural ecosystems of great ecological relevance and scenic beauty, enabling scientific research, environmental education, outdoors recreation and eco-tourism https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Chapada_Diamantina_National_Park The Best of Brazil . The region became famous during the 19th century for the Diamond exploration, that lasted until 1990, when the National Park was finally founded, considered today one of the most beautiful National Parks in Brazil. Morro do Pai Inácio One of the most well known and popular of the Chapada Diamantina’s attractions, the Morro do Pai Inácio, has an altitude of 1,120m and is easy to get to. This popular tourist attraction in the Parque Nacional da Chapada Diamantina, is found in the region of Palmeiras, and the view from the top of the mountain is truly unforgettable. 250m from the top of the Morro do Pai Inácio you can see the Morro do Camelo, the Vale do Capão and the Morrão, as well as being the spot for one of the Chapada Diamantina’s classic postcard shots: the sunset of the Morro do Pai Inácio. It is relatively easy to get to the Morro do Pai Inácio in the Chapada Diamantina. The trail is along the edge of the BR-242, about 27km from Palmeiras and 26km from the town of Lençóis. http://www.chapadadiamantinabahia.com/en/sobre-lencois/atrativos/morro-do-pai-inacio Poço do Diabo Poço do Diabo is a Waterfall formed by rio Mucugezinho with about 20 meters tall and has option Rappelling and Zip Lining with 70 meters in length. The high iron concentration is responsible for the dark reddish color of the water. Ponds depth varies 2 meters to 4 meters, it is great for swimming. DON'T CLICK HERE: https://bit.ly/37o9fGv
